reddit 技能通过公开 JSON API 获取 Reddit 帖子、评论串、subreddit 元数据和用户资料。它适合做 Reddit 研究、subreddit 扫描,以及需要真实帖子而不是泛泛摘要的来源可追溯网页研究。无需 API key。

Stars0
收藏0
评论0
收录时间2026年5月9日
分类Web 研究
安装命令
npx skills add ReScienceLab/opc-skills --skill reddit
编辑评分

该技能得分 78/100,说明它适合作为目录中的可选条目:它提供了真实可用的 Reddit 只读工作流,触发场景也比较明确,但如果补充更完整的端到端使用说明和安装背景会更有帮助。需要搜索 Reddit、抓取帖子/评论,或查看 subreddit/用户信息的用户,应该能找到足够的价值来决定安装。

78/100
亮点
  • 对 Reddit、subreddit 和 r/ 链接给出了明确的触发指引,便于代理判断何时调用。
  • 覆盖了关键工作流的具体命令:subreddit 帖子、搜索、帖子+评论、subreddit 信息和用户资料。
  • 通过可执行脚本和无需认证的公开 JSON API 体现出较强的可操作性,降低了配置门槛。
注意点
  • SKILL.md 摘要里有命令和快速检查,但没有安装命令,因此实际采用时可能需要手动配置并做一些猜测。
  • 工作流文档在约束和边界情况上的说明偏少;仓库也没有专门的 references/rules/resources 来补充操作指引。
概览

reddit skill 概览

reddit skill 能做什么

reddit skill 可以通过 Reddit 的公开 JSON API,帮你检索 Reddit 帖子、评论串、subreddit 元数据和用户资料。它很适合做 Reddit 调研、社区扫描和素材收集,尤其是在你需要真实帖子而不是泛化摘要时。

最适合的使用场景

当你需要查看 r/ 社区、对比帖子热度随时间的变化、阅读某个线程下的评论,或者确认某个用户最近发了什么时,就适合用这个 reddit skill。它在 reddit for Web Research 工作流里尤其有用,因为这类任务很看重来源可追溯性。

为什么值得安装这个 skill

它最大的优点是 reddit install 路径非常轻量:不需要 API key,脚本的职责也很单一。这让 reddit skill 很适合快速查询,接入成本低;但也意味着它更适合只读研究,而不是重自动化流水线。

如何使用 reddit skill

安装并验证这个 skill

先用 npx skills add ReScienceLab/opc-skills --skill reddit 安装,然后确认脚本能从 skill 目录正常运行。一个快速的自检命令是 python3 scripts/get_posts.py python --limit 3,它可以验证公开 JSON API 路径和本地运行环境是否正常。

从正确的输入开始

reddit skill 最适合你提供 subreddit 名称、帖子 ID、用户名,或者带足够上下文的搜索短语来缩小范围。好的提示词例如:“Use the reddit skill to compare recent r/ClaudeAI posts about MCP servers” 或者 “Use reddit for Web Research to pull comments from post abc123 and summarize the strongest arguments.”

先阅读这些关键 repo 文件

实际使用时,先读 SKILL.md,再查看 scripts/reddit_api.pyscripts/get_posts.pyscripts/search_posts.pyscripts/get_post.pyscripts/get_subreddit.pyscripts/get_user.py.claude-plugin/plugin.json 也很有用,它能帮助你理解这个 skill 是如何打包以及对外暴露的。

能明显提升输出质量的工作流建议

按目标选命令:get_posts.py 用于 subreddit 信息流,search_posts.py 用于话题发现,get_post.py 用于评论,get_subreddit.py 用于社区统计,get_user.py 用于用户历史。想把 reddit 用好,最好一开始就明确排序方式、时间范围和结果数量,这样第一次拉取的数据就更接近可直接决策的状态。

reddit skill 常见问题

reddit 需要 API key 吗?

不需要。这个 reddit skill 使用 Reddit 的公开 JSON API,面向只读访问来设计。这样能降低安装门槛,但在高频使用时,你仍然要预期会遇到偶发的限流。

它比直接写一个关于 Reddit 的普通提示词更好吗?

如果你需要可复现的检索,答案是肯定的。普通提示词只能泛泛描述 Reddit,而 reddit skill 会真正抓取帖子、评论、subreddit 信息和用户数据,这对有来源支撑的研究要有用得多。

什么情况下不该用 reddit skill?

如果你需要写入操作、版务操作,或者必须保证覆盖所有最新内容,就不该用它。它也不适合依赖私有数据、登录后视图,或长时间持续抓取的任务。

reddit skill 适合新手吗?

适合,前提是先从简单查询开始,比如一个 subreddit 名称或帖子 ID。命令本身很短,也比较可预测,但新手如果能明确自己想看 hot posts、new posts、top posts 还是 comments,结果会好很多。

如何改进 reddit skill

把检索目标说得足够具体

提升效果最大的方式,就是把要抓取的对象说清楚。不要只说“research Reddit about AI”,而要改成“top r/AI posts from the last week”、“comments on post abc123”或“recent posts by spez”,因为不同目标会触发不同的脚本和输出结构。

明确排序、时间范围和数量上限

很多 reddit 输出效果差,根源就是检索约束缺失。如果你关心趋势,就加上 --sort top --time week;如果你关心新近内容,就用 --sort new;如果你关心覆盖面,可以谨慎提高 --limit,但不要指望这个 API 的行为像完整归档一样。

直接说明你后续需要的格式

如果你要分析,就在同一个请求里说清楚:“pull the results and extract recurring objections”、“compare subreddit norms” 或 “summarize the top comment themes”。如果你只要求原始抓取,那么 reddit skill 对 reddit for Web Research 的帮助,往往不如把研究问题先框定好的提示词。

注意常见失败模式

主要限制包括限流、评论可见性不完整,以及 subreddit 名称有歧义。结果看起来很少时,可以试试更窄的 subreddit、不同的排序,或者直接使用帖子 ID;如果要改进 reddit skill 本身,最值得优先优化的是更清晰的输出格式、更好的错误处理,以及在 SKILL.md 里加入更明确的示例。

评分与评论

暂无评分
分享你的评价
登录后即可为这个技能评分并发表评论。
G
0/10000
最新评论
保存中...